Our Verdict
"The Grid"
At a median of ฿237.5/m², this area sits firmly in THE_GRID category—it is functional and predictable, but don't expect a bargain unless you are looking at unrenovated builds. The ฿480/m² peak is likely skewed by a few high-end villas with private pools, whereas our neighborhood analysis suggests the real value lies closer to the ฿150 mark. The investment outlook remains stable due to the proximity of international schools, but with only a few data points available, renters have the upper hand to haggle.
The Vibe:This is Hang Dong sprawl at its most honest—mostly quiet residential streets and rice field views that are slowly being filled by gated developments. You're far enough from the city center to escape the worst of the congestion, but you'll spend a significant amount of time on Route 108 if you commute daily. The crowd is a mix of long-term expats chasing more space and locals tied to the nearby Baan Tawai woodcarving trade.

Locals Ask
Is ฿237.5/m² expensive for this part of Hang Dong?
It is on the higher side for the median, mostly reflecting newer mooban developments rather than the older, local housing stock.
Do I need a car to live in Ban Han Kaeo?
Absolutely; unless you enjoy waiting for yellow songthaews on the dusty shoulder of Route 108, own wheels are mandatory.
What explains the massive ฿95 to ฿480/m² price gap?
You are seeing the difference between basic concrete shophouses and luxury gated villas with full western kitchens and pools.
Is the area prone to seasonal flooding?
Some low-lying plots near the local canals can get soggy during the monsoon, so check the elevation before signing a long-term lease.
Is there any nightlife or dining within walking distance?
Unless you live directly adjacent to Kad Farang, your 'nightlife' will be limited to local noodle stalls and 7-Eleven runs.
